Not sure of this product in particular....however in my experience paint prot, upolstery prot. and dealer window tint is just THEIR cream $$.
I think I was offered window tint for about $660 on a VF ute. The contractor they use to do it charges around $220 to do it direct.

Had it done as part of the lease package in 06 when I got my VE SS

Wouldnt bother with it actually.

They missed a strip down the middle of the roof.

Looked shocking when I first washed it.

I waxed it with Meguiars Tech Wax and it covered up their stuff up and it never showed up again in the few years I owned it.

Wax the paint well, and use Scotchgard on the cloth seats, and you will have possibly a better result than they offer

A dealership here years ago, used to get the better tint shop to apply their decal under the tint, to give the impression that you were getting a superior product, that was only available through them, same tint double the price with a name change. & another dealership got 1 of our guy's to do their complete protection packages for them & they charged 50% - 60% mark up for making a phone call basically. Imo meguires car polishes ect, are just as good.
